    • Good to know
      M. foggii (M. figo x M. doltsopa). Can be pruned after flowering to maintain compactness
    • Pests & Diseases
      Scale insects, red spider mites under glass. Honey fungus, coral spot
    • Place of origin
      Garden origin. New Zealand. pre 1996. Os Blumhardt
